Skip to content

Latest commit

 

History

History
202 lines (87 loc) · 13.5 KB

examen.md

File metadata and controls

202 lines (87 loc) · 13.5 KB

EXÁMEN PERIODISMO DE DATOS

Lucía Hernández Gonzálezál

  1. ¿Qué es el periodismo de datos? Aporta tus impresiones sobre el debate.

El periodismo de datos es una especialidad del periodismo que trata de recabar y analizar grandes cantidades de datos mediante software especializado, con la intención de hacer comprensible la informaciónón para los lectores, en forma de visualizaciones efecti. En mi opinión la parte de visualización de datos, que conlleva el análisis y filtración anterior, es esencial para la demanda de información actual que busca obtener información clara y simplificada.

  1. Cuando hablamos de periodismo o visualización de datos, ¿a qué datos nos referimos? Razona la respuesta.

El periodismo de datos usa la visualización de datos tanto en la etapa de análisis como en la de la presentación de resultados. No se puede hablar de periodismo y visualización sin análisis, pero la visualización remite también al análisis de datos. Por tanto, cuando hablamos de visualización de datos, nos referimos también a la visualización del análisis de los datos.

  1. ¿Qué medio de comunicación inglés es fundamental en el periodismo y la visualización de datos?

The Guardian es un medio fundamental en el periodismo y visualización de datos porque es el pionero del periodismo de datos moderno. Y actualmente uno de los que más recurre al tratamiento y visualización de datos en su contenido informativo

  1. Qué lenguajes informáticos conoces. Razona la respuesta.

Los lenguajes informáticos son todos los que entiende o puede entender el ordenador (a través de software). Dentro de los lenguajes informáticos están los lenguajes estructurados, como puede ser HTML, que sirve para estructurar documentos. Y también están los lenguajes de programación que sirven para programar acciones que haga el ordenador. Entre estos se encuentran Java, C, C#, Python o R. En la web se utiliza mucho JavaScript, es el que aporta la interactividad. Los que mas he utilizado y por tanto, los que mas conozco de manera práctica son, HTML y Java.

  1. Cuál es la diferencia entre Internet y la Web. Razona la respuesta.

Internet es una red de redes, es decir, una red de computadoras de todo el mundo, que están conectadas entre sí. Y por otro lado, la web es una colección de páginas que se asienta sobre esta red de computadoras de internet. Osea que usamos internet para acceder a la web

  1. ¿Qué fue determinante para el nacimiento del periodismo de datos moderno?

El periodismo de datos moderno, del que bebemos actualmente, nace en 2006-2008 con una combinación de factores: abundancia de software de código abierto HTML5 y Open Data.

  1. Qué saberes están implicados en periodismo de datos. Razona la respuesta.

Tiene tres aspectos fundamentales: el periodismo, los datos y la visualizaciónón de datos. Los tres son importantes para el periodismo y para la información, pero hay que tener en cuenta que la visualización va más allá del resultado final que podemos observar. En este proceso tambien se aplican tecnicas estadisticas, programas informaticos que hacen que del resultado de la visualización podamos obtener conclusiones y resultados.

  1. Cuál es la materia del periodismo de datos. Razona la respuesta

El periodismo de datos, es un método de producción de noticias orientado al uso de informaciones y elementos de valor numérico que tienen el objetivo de producir correlaciones que permitan llegar a conclusiones precisas y relevantes sobre temas que interesan a los lectores.

  1. Qué tipos de interfaces de datos hay

Hay tres tipos de interfaces aunque hemos visto dos: CLI de Command Line Interfaces o interfaces de línea de comandos, GUI de Graphical User Interfaces o interfaces gráficas de usuario. Y capacitivas, que son las de los móviles.

  1. Qué tipos de datos hay

Numéricos: Corresponden a un identificador, que en este caso está compuesto por números. Strings: cadena de caracteres o literales al texto norma. Y Booleanos, que representan dos valores de una lógica binaria. "Verdadero o Falso", "True or False", "Sí o No", "0 o 1", etc (el nombre se debe a George Boole, ya que desarrolló un sistema de reglas que le permitían expresar, manipular y simplificar problemas lógicos y filosóficos cuyos argumentos admiten dos estados (verdadero o falso) por procedimientos matemáticos)

  1. ¿Qué significa el funcionamiento "cliente-servidor"?

La red cliente-servidor es una red de comunicaciones en la cual los clientes están conectados a un servidor, en el que se centralizan los diversos recursos y aplicaciones con que se cuenta. Y que posteriormente, los pone a disposición de los clientes cada vez que estos son solicitados.

  1. ¿Qué relación tiene el formato CSV con Excel?

Excel es una aplicación para visualizar datos tabulados, y el formato CSV muestra los datos separados por comas, por lo que ambos tratan de facilitar o hacer más sencillo el tratamiento de datos.

  1. Cuál fue el comienzo del CAR (Computer Assisted Reporting)?

El comienzo de Computer Assited Reporting lleva funcionando en Estados Unidos desde 1950. Como pasó en su dia con el diseño gráfico, a este tipo de periodismo se le denominó así por tratarse de un periodismo "asistido por ordenador".

  1. ¿Qué tipos de formatos de datos hay? ¿Que similitudes y diferencias tienen?

Hay varios tipos de formatos:

  1. XML, Significa eXtensible Markup Language: es muy complej
  2. JSON: Significa o JavaScript Object Notation. Son los ficheros que mejor funcionan con aplicaciones web. Permite más complejidad que los *SV, pero también es más difícil de leer.
  3. CSV, Significa Valores Separados por Comas: Es el más usado y el más sencillo de utilizar, pero el menos estandarizado. La mayoría de bases de recursos disponibles en los catálogos de datos abiertos se encuentran en este formato.

Su mayor diferencia es la diferente complejidad de uso que tienen unos y otros.

  1. ¿Qué programas se pueden utilizar para usar la terminal en Windows?

Cygwin es un conjunto amplio de herramientas GNU y de código abierto que ofrecen una funcionalidad similar a una distribución Linux en Windows. Tiene algunas desventajas conocidas, como la instalación, actualización o la usabilidad de la instalación Para actualizar o instalar programas se puede utilizar apt-cig

  1. ¿Qué programa sirve para gestionar programas en la terminal de OSX?

Brew es un gestor de programas en MacOSX, que sirve para instalar programas que se usan en la Terminal. Hay una alternativa llamada macports.org, pero ambos no son incompatibles.

  1. ¿Qué es nano?

Nano es un editor de texto minimalista de la línea de comandos, que además tiene otras características que lo hacen útil como modificar archivos de configuración en la terminal, crear lanzadores, etc.

  1. ¿Qué es Bootstrap?

Es una biblioteca multipataforma o un conjunto de código abierto que se utiliza pra el diseño de sitios y aplicaciones web.

  1. ¿Qué son git y Github?

Github es la suma de git (el software) y hub (el espacio montado por GitHub. Git se utiliza en proyectos de software. Es un programa para el trabajo colaborativo y distribuido. Lo crea Linus Torvalds, el mismo creador del kernel Linux para el desarrollo del kernel. Entre sus funciones, permite ramas de los proyectos que luego pueden integrarse, permite volver a momentos concretos de los proyectos y permite más de un servidor. Github en cambio, es una forja para alojar proyectos utilizando el sistema de control de versiones Git. Se utiliza para la creación de código fuente de programas de ordenador. El software que opera Git fue escrito en Ruby.

  1. ¿Cuál es la versión de Shell qué utilizas?

Se puede comprobar qué shell tienes con el comando echo $SHELL. Por tanto, al ponerlo me sale: /bin/zsh

  1. ¿Qué hay que hacer para ver el valor de la variable de entorno de shell "PATH" con el comando "echo"?

Para conocer el valor de la variable PATH se debe de escribir en la terminal: echo $PATH

  1. ¿En qué se diferencian las rutas absolutas de las relativas? Pon ejemplos de ambas.

En una ruta absoluta se representa la ruta completa del recurso. Dicho de otra forma, se parte desde el directorio raíz hasta llegar al recurso, por ejemplo: /home/zeokat/vozidea/file.txt . En cambio, en las rutas relativas se representa sólo una parte de la ruta. Esto es posible porque en las rutas relativas se tiene en cuenta el directorio actual de trabajo. Un ejemplo de esto sería: vozidea/file.txt.

  1. Qué son las entidades HTML y cómo se representan. Por un ejemplo

Las entidades HTML son un conjunto de caracteres o string que empiezan por un ampersand & y terminan con un ; punto y coma. Por ejemplo, el carácter á se escribe á; el carácter é se escribe é, etc. Se representan por tanto, por sus caracteres o atributos.

  1. ¿Qué función tiene la almohadilla en Markdown y en un programa de la shell? Razona tu respuesta.

En Markdawn la almohadilla sirve para crear títulos y subtítulos. se pone delante del texto, separada por un espacio en blanco. Para crear subtítulos y, por lo tanto, en letra más pequeña, se insertan más almohadillas. De esta manera, se pueden crear hasta seis niveles de títulos, como en HTML. Sin embargo, en un programa de la Shell, cualquier palabra que empiece por una almohadilla (#). La palabra y todos los caracteres que le siguen, hasta el siguiente carácter de nueva línea, se pasan por alto.

  1. ¿Cómo ves todos los dialectos de la shell disponibles?

Poniendo en la terminal: cat /etc/shells.

  1. Pon un par de ejemplos de Google Dorks u "operadores de búsqueda"

“término de búsqueda”: Fuerza una búsqueda de coincidencia exacta. Usa esto para refinar los resultados de las búsquedas ambiguas, o para excluir los sinónimos en la búsqueda de palabras sueltas. Ejemplo: “Steve Jobs”

OR: Busca X o Y. Esto devolverá resultados relacionados con X ó Y, o ambos. Nota: El operador de barra vertical (|) puede también ser utilizado en lugar de “OR”. Ejemplos: jobs OR gates / jobs | gates

AND: Busca X y Y. Esto solo generará resultados relacionados con X y Y. Nota: En realidad no hay mucha diferencia con las búsquedas regulares, pues Google agrega por defecto el “Y” de todos modos. Pero es muy útil cuando se combina con otros operadores. Ejemplo: jobs AND gates

  1. ¿Qué es una API. Pon algún ejemplo.

API significa interfaz de programación de acceso o Assist Programming Interface. Esto vendría a referirse a los códigos para comunicarse en la web. Un ejemplo de API es HTTP.

  1. ¿Qué es Markdown?

Es un lenguaje de mercado ligero que trata de conseguir la máxima legibilidad y facilidad de publicaciónón tanto en su forma de entrada como de salida. Su creador fue John Gruber.

  1. Explica la URL https://github.com/pontedatos/uc3m-periodismo-datos

https://, que se utiliza para indicar el protocolo usado. https en el dominio que sea. La separación entre protocolo y dominio se lleva a cabo con ://

El dominio, es decir: github.com

La estructura de carpetas del servidor web, es decir: pontedatos/uc3m-periodismo-datos

  1. Si quisieras clonar un repositorio git, ¿qué pasos tendrías que dar?

Para clonar un repositorio git habría que entrar en el repositorio de GitHub y seleccionar en un botón verde la opción de "Clone". Esto genera un código que se utiliza después en la terminal. Para conectarlos deberemos hacer: git clone + el código creado. Esto conecta la terminal y el repositorio. Una vez que queramos abrir nuestro repositorio en la terminal debemos hacer cd + nombre del repositorio y, a partir de ese momento, todo lo que hagamos en la terminal se conectará a GitHub.

Por ejemplo, si has creado un texto en nano y quieres que aparezca en tu repositorio deberás hacer lo siguiente: Primero, git add "nombredelarchivo". Luego, git commit -m "acción" (por ejemplo: suboarchivo"). Y por último, git push main origin. T

  1. ¿Qué harías si al ejecutar un comando te salta el aviso "command not found"?

Primero revisar si lo he escrito bien. Y si no fuese este el problema, leer los mensajes que da el software e intentar interpretarlos para ver si me está resolviendo el problema

  1. ¿Cómo harías para que OpenRefine interpretara correctamente los tipos de datos?

Teniendo delante OpenRefine, abriría la pestaña de Edit cells. A partir de esta, la de Common transformations. Y posteriormente elegiría “To date, to number…” según fuese necesario.

  1. Cuál es la diferencia entre XLS y XLSX

XLA es la extensión de los archivos de Excel pero en sus versiones de 1997 al 2003. En cambio, los archivos XLSX, son los de las versiones de Excel más modernas.

  1. ¿Quién es Philip Meyer?

Es un profesor emérito y titular de la cátedra Knight de Periodismo en la Universidad de Carolina del Norte. Ha llevado a cabo investigaciones acerca de la calidad y precisión en el periodismo y la tecnología de la comunicación. Además aunque parece una disciplina muy reciente, ya en 1960 bautizó a lo que hoy conocemos como periodismo de datos, como "periodismo de precisión”.

  1. ¿Quién fue Florence Nightingale

Fue una escritora y estadística británica que surgió desde muy joven su habilidad para clasificar, analizar y documentar datos. Fue importante tambien por su asentar las bases de la profesionalzacion de la enfermedadia y por incluir en ello el campo de la estadistica médica. Se dio cuenta de la importancia de disponer datos precisos y ordenados para poder entender como y porque sucedian las cosas y esto ayudaó a salvar muchas vidas.